Overview

This is a fully functional demo. Some simple configuration has been added for clearer demonstration of OpenEMR, medical billing, accounting, access controls and patient portals. Don't worry about breaking it, because this demo resets itself to original state daily at 4:02 AM Pacific US time. We also offer a 4.1.2 demo with the most recent patch and a full panel of Development Demos (these are demos that are rebuilt daily or weekly from most recent development code) where you can test out new features.

Z&H Healthcare Patient Portal

This third party patient portal actually consists of both a provider portal (within OpenEMR) and a patient portal on an external website (which communicates with OpenEMR).
